Bora Chuk No-2 - Doom Dooma, Tinsukia
Bora Chuk No-2 is a village situated in the Doom Dooma subdivision of Tinsukia district, Assam. It is located approximately 21 km from the tehsil headquarters in Doom Dooma and around 47 km from the district headquarters in Tinsukia. Kakopathar ser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bora Chuk No-2 village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Bora Chuk No-2 is 290347. The village covers a total geographical area of 89.82 hectares and falls under the 786152 pincode. Doomdoma is the nearest town, located about 21 km away.
Bora Chuk No-2 village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Sadiya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Lakhimp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Bora Chuk No-2
As per Census 2011, Bora Chuk No-2 village has a total population of 256 people, consisting of 134 males and 122 females. The village has 48 households and a sex ratio of 910 females per 1,000 males. There are 30 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 204 literate and 52 illiterate residents.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Bora Chuk No-2 are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 256 | 134 | 122 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 30 | 16 | 14 |
| Literate Population | 204 | 109 | 95 |
| Illiterate Population | 52 | 25 | 27 |

Transport and Connectivity of Bora Chuk No-2
Public transport in the Bora Chuk No-2 is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Bora Chuk No-2.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| Available within >10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Doomdoma to Bora Chuk No-2 is about 21 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Tinsukia to Bora Chuk No-2 is about 47 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.3 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Bora Chuk No-2
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Bora Chuk No-2 village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 2-5 km |
Health Facilities in Bora Chuk No-2
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Bora Chuk No-2 village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
